默认情况时:设置了hint的话,需要输入的时候hint才会消失,但是现在是需要当edittext获取焦点时就让hint消失

代码如下:

verifycode= (EditText)findViewById(R.id.verifycode);        verifycode.setOnFocusChangeListener(new View.OnFocusChangeListener() {            @Override            public void onFocusChange(View v, boolean hasFocus) {                EditText _e = (EditText)v;                if(!hasFocus)  //没有焦点                {                    _e.setHint(_e.getTag().toString());                }                else  //获取到焦点                {                    _e.setTag(_e.getHint().toString());                    _e.setHint("");                }            }        });

更多相关文章

  1. 没有一行代码,「2020 新冠肺炎记忆」这个项目却登上了 GitHub 中
  2. Android设备不root,从App目录下拷贝文件
  3. [工作积累] android 中添加libssl和libcurl
  4. Android(安卓)动画实现弹幕效果
  5. Android(安卓)自定义loading
  6. Android(安卓)调试查看内存使用情况
  7. Android(安卓)SimpleAdapter显示ListView、GridView
  8. Android(安卓)Audio代码分析9 - AudioTrack::write函数
  9. Android常用代码集合

随机推荐

  1. Android(安卓)系统信息获取(CPU,RAM,ROM,
  2. Android 清除数据
  3. RadioGroup ,CheckBox ,Toast
  4. android动画效果演示
  5. Android创建项目
  6. android水平循环滚动控件使用详解
  7. android从网络获取图片
  8. Android NumberPickerDialog
  9. Android 拦截TextView中超链接点击事件
  10. 往Android Studio中导入项目时遇到Instal